Step 1: Containment and Assessment
Our technicians arrive equipped with the right gear to contain the water and assess the damage. We use moisture-reading meters to find out the extent of the water penetration. This helps us develop an effective plan to restore your home.
Step 2: Extraction and Removal
Next, we use powerful extractors to remove standing water from the affected area. This is a crucial step in preventing further damage and reducing drying times. We also use specialized equipment to remove water from behind walls and under floors, where it can be most difficult to reach.
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ification
After the water is removed, we use specialized equipment to dry and dehumidify the affected area. This involves the use of high-velocity fans and dehumidifiers to speed up the drying process and prevent secondary damage.
Step 4: Disinfection and Sanitizing
Finally, we disinfect and sanitize the affected area to prevent the growth of mold and bacteria. This is an essential step in ensuring your home is safe to occupy and free from potential health risks.

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away
Strong musty odors can show the presence of mold and mildew, which can grow in damp environments. If you notice a persistent, unpleasant smell in your home, it’s time to call a professional.
Visible Water Stains on Walls and Ceilings
Water stains on walls and ceilings can be a sign of a larger issue, water seeping into your home’s structure. Don’t ignore these signs, they can lead to costly repairs down the line.
Warped or Buckled Flooring
Warped or buckled flooring can be a sign of water damage, which can compromise the structural integrity of your home. If you notice your floors are uneven or sagging, it’s time to call a professional.
Discolored or Peeling Paint
Discolored or peeling paint can show water damage or high humidity levels in your home. Don’t ignore these signs, they can lead to costly repairs and even health risks.
Water Damage on Your Belongings
Water damage on your belongings can be a sign of a larger issue, water seeping into your home’s structure. If you notice water damage on your furniture, carpets, or other belongings, it’s time to call a professional.
Gutter Overflow Water Removal vs. DIY: When to Call a Professional
| Situation | DIY? | Call a Pro? | Why |
|---|---|---|---|
| Small water spill (less than 1 gallon) | Yes | No | No equipment needed, easy cleanup. |
| Sizeable water spill (1-10 gallons) | No | Yes | Specialized equipment needed for safe and effective cleanup. |
| Standing water (over 10 gallons) | No | Yes | High risk of secondary damage and health risks. |
| Water damage affects structural integrity | No | Yes | Structural damage can compromise your home’s safety and value. |
| Water damage affects electrical systems | No | Yes | Electrical shock and fires are significant risks. |
| Water damage affects HVAC systems | No | Yes | Water damage can compromise HVAC system performance and safety. |

Can I Prevent Gutter Overflow Water Damage?
Yes, regular gutter maintenance can help prevent gutter overflow water damage. We recommend cleaning your gutters at least twice a year and inspecting them for damage or blockages. Our team can also provide guidance on how to maintain your gutters and prevent future damage.
